Entry Way Fall Decor
Freshen up the front door. A simple wreath or an array of pumpkins at the entry are clever ideas to give a festive feel. Don’t you just love this cheery, yellow front door?
Hit the craft store for faux pumpkins and flowers to craft this stunning topiary that’ll brighten up your front porch from the start of fall until it’s time to swap it out for holiday decorations. Best of all: the faux materials ensure that this topiary will keep its good looks for many falls to come. I am in love with the way these pumpkin floral arrangements turned out!
Simple Touches on Tables
Filling a decorative container or vase with a festive mix of pinecones and pumpkins makes a beautiful display.
